here is a post on adjusting the Mustang Cobra caliper pistons. You should be able to find others with more detail, but it appears that setting the parking brake adjusts the caliper piston, so now that you have the parking brake cables routed properly set and release the parking brake a few times an see if that helps.

I would also check again to be absolutely sure the rear brake lines are bled and have no trapped air.
